I'm signal boosting what I think are two great suggestions.
Are you tired of typing <user name=noracharles> every time you want
noracharles? Or worse, typing <user name=nora_charles site=livejournal.com> every time you want
nora_charles?
As far as I understand, on twitter if I were to write "I went to see a movie with Ximeria yesterday", then
ximeria would not see it unless she went looking for it, but if I were to write "I went to see a movie with @ximeria yesterday", then she would know that I was inviting her to read or join the conversation if she felt like it. Would you like that option in dreamwidth as well?
Please take a look at this comment, where I summarize a suggestion made by
desh to be able to mention other users in a way which notifies them of that mention and a suggestion made by
mark to be able to write usernames in a much shorter, handier, easier to remember way. Reply to that comment with your opinion :-D
